WORKSHOP—EMERGENCY PREPAREDNESS BEGINS AT HOME
On Saturday, October 18, at 10 a.m., the Watertown Commission on Disability and Watertown’s Emergency Management Coalition are sponsoring a workshop on how to plan for emergencies. The workshop will be held at the Watertown Free Public Library, 123 Main Street, in the Watertown Savings Bank meeting room.
Should you attend this workshop? Ask yourself these questions: Could you survive at home for up to three days on your own? Could you leave home within a few minutes with the basic things you would need? If you answered “no,” you are not alone. Come and find out why emergency preparedness begins at home.
You will learn about:
•the basic supplies you’d need at home;
•what you’d need packed and ready in a go-kit;
•how to plan for your household’s unique needs; and
•how to do it without spending a lot of time or money.
